But a respected media source reports that Madrid are already lining up their major transfer targets for the summer.

In response to recent speculation about Lukaku’s future Italian sports media outlet Gazetta World says:

“Moving to Juve could be a great move but watch out for PSG and Real Madrid.”

The 22-year-old has been on fire for Everton, scoring 61 in 117 appearances for the club, but he recently stated his desire to play in The Champions League next term in a what some will see as a clear come and get me plea:

“That is the next step for me. I’m 23 next summer and I think it would be nice to play in the Champions League from next season.”

With lots of reported interest from several other mammoth clubs this could be one of the big transfers of the summer with his current club not keen to sell.

But we would suggest that the player is absolutely ideal for The Premier League so perhaps he is more likely to stay in England than to move to Real Madrid.

Lukaku has scored 12 goals in 43 caps for Belgium.
